That would create very bad pacing and general inconsistencies because instead of 1real->1generated->1real you will have all kind of skips that would make it worst rather than better. Stuff like 1real->1generated->1real ->1real->1generated->1real will only make the things worst as presentation
at the moment dlss, fsr, and LS frame gens all work 1real->1generated->1real
enabling the fg eats additional resources, so in the dlss fg demo videos you can see the person getting 70 fps pre-fg
but after fg they get ~120
oh ok
that is because additional GPU resources are used for the FG algo to work, and due to that the real fps of the game falls to 60, so when interpolated it goes to 120
